Font generation is necessary for LeonardoSpectrum to run on UNIX platforms due to MainWin applications Font generation effectively maps Windows fonts to X Server fonts Font generation can take a considerable amount of time at startup In order to avoid font generation at startup LeonardoSpectrum takes advantage of font caching Effectively generated fonts are stored in a file which LeonardoSpectrum can later access during subsequent invocations The name of the cache file is derived from the version of the X server DISP LAY variable and the font path name LeonardoSpectrum defaults to creating a font cache directory on a per user basis in the leonardo_spectrum directory The system administrator can change the font cache directory by modifying the variable MWFONT_CACHE_DIR in SEXEMPLAR bin xmplr init file Hardware and Software Requirements PC and UNIX Quick Installation Type of PC An IBM compatible PC with a Pentium or Pentium Pro CPU is recommended Operating System PC LeonardoSpectrum requires Windows 95 98 NT 1 5 UNIX Solaris 2 5 1 2 6 HP UX 10 20 for HP700 environments Disk Space LeonardoSpectrum requires approximately 80 MBytes of disk space for programs and data files Plan for an additional 50 MBytes for your design and intermediate files System Memory RAM Requirements Table 1 1 System Memory Requirements shows the recommended memory for proper operation of LeonardoSpectru
6. file A If you are having problems with your license manager and you do not have a log file bring the license manager daemon down and back up this time with a log file The log file is the quickest and easiest method for determining what is causing problems with a license file To bring the current license manager daemon down do the following you should be logged in as root or the same user who started 1mgrd lImutil lmdown c license file pathname Then restart the license manager daemon as directed lmgrd c license file pathname gt license file logname amp You can then review the log file to determine what is causing your problems For windows if you run lmgrd as a service the log file is c windows system32 lmgrd log FLEXIm License Administration 4 5 4 6 When I bring down the license manager daemon will this kill any programs currently using the license manager Most FLEXIm programs will attempt to reconnect to a vendor daemon if that connection is lost The default of FLEXIm is to check the connection every 30 seconds if a lost connection is discovered the default is to recheck five times at one minute intervals Although all of this may differ from one program to another most programs do not have a problem when a connection is lost as long as the connection is reestablished usually within five minutes Why do I have to bring the license manager down and back up instead of just using Im

21. llation program handles the setting of these environment variables for you To set or modify them manually on Windows NT use the System dialog in the Control Panel on your PC see following instructions on Windows 95 98 add or modify the set and path commands as shown above in your autoexec bat file Refer to the documentation that accompanies your operating system or contact your system administrator for further details Steps for Setting Environment Variables on Windows NT 1 Bring up the System Properties dialog Start gt Settings gt Control Panel gt Systems and click on the Environment folder 2 If you want these changes to apply to all users of the system modify the System Environment Variables according to the following instructions If you want these changes to apply only to the current user modify the User Environment Variables e Select the variable from the appropriate list System or User if it already exists or select another variable from that list and change the Variable name to the one you are setting EXEMPLAR Path or LM_LICENSE_FILE e Enter the value of the variable in the Value field If you are setting the Path environment variable you do not need to enter PATH also if you are modifying the User Environment Path you do not need to repeat the System Environment Path setting This variable is automatically concatenated and includes both the System and the User values e Click on the Set button to add your

30. ools see the following sections Usage of 1mdown and 1mremove should be restricted as these utilities can severely disrupt application program usage Use the following utilities for information e lmutil lmhostid Reports the exact hostid that the license manager expects to use on any given machine e lmutil lmver filename Reports the license manager version of the license manager daemon lmgrd or vendor daemon modeltech exemplard or mgcld On Windows these utilities may also be run from the Imtools program called License Administration Utilities in your Exemplar Program Group For more information on these utilities refer to the FLEXIm End User Manual at http www Globetrotter com manual htm or contact Globetrotter Software at info globetrotter com Backup Redundant Servers If the LeonardoSpectrum software is located on a single file server only a single license server should be used If the software is installed on two or more servers and if you want to continue to work when one of the servers goes off line you may want to use backup license servers Only in very volatile situations or in very large networks should more than three servers be required because the system remains fully functional as long as a simple majority of the servers are running To use backup license servers a copy of the license file must be located on each server In addition the 1mgrd and license daemons modeltech exemplard or

33. r and it uses port number 1700 for the license manager daemon type set LM _LICENSE_FILE 1700 master Q Do I need a new license for my Sun to add an HP or a PC A No if you have an existing Sun license server you can put the HP or PC on the network The HP or PC can use the same LM_LICENSE_FILE as the Sun FLEXIm License Administration 4 7 ei Q I edited the license file how do I make sure I did not accidentally corrupt it A A quick way to check the integrity of the license files is lmutil lmcksum c license_file 4 8 LeonardoSpectrum Installation Index A authorization codes 1 7 3 2 D device driver Dallas Semiconductor 2 2 Rainbow 2 1 dongle GLOBEtrotter 2 2 instructions 1 1 E environment variables 2 3 EXEMPLAR environment variable 3 1 F FEATURE line exemplard daemon 2 6 mgcld daemon 2 6 modeltech daemon 2 6 FLEXIm license manager 2 4 floating license 2 4 floating license file exemplard daemon 2 5 mgcld daemon 2 5 modeltech daemon 2 5 H hardware and software requirements 1 5 hostid Dallas Semiconductor dongle 2 2 disk serial number 1 7 dongle ID 1 7 Exemplar old style Rainbow dongle 2 2 Rainbow dongle 2 2 I Installing Mentor Licensing 1 9 L license DAEMON line 2 6 SERVER line 2 6 license daemon exemplard 1 7 1 8 Mentor Graphics 1 8 mgcld 3 3 Model Technology 1 8 M mount command 1 3 N node locked license 2 4 exemplard daemon

41. util lmreread There is a known problem with lmutil lmreread involving timing particularly if your license file is large the request to restart one or more vendor daemons may be processed before the request to shut them down has finished The net result is that the vendor daemon is shut down but not restarted It is safer to use Imutil 1mdown followed by lmgrd How do I know if it is OK to merge my license files You may merge all license files that run on the same server and have the same hostid specified on the SERVER line if multiple SERVER lines are used all must match Note that it does not matter if the port number on the SERVER line does not match because this is user specified the default is 1700 Why do I have to use Imutil Imdown instead of just killing the lmgrd process When you kill the 1mgrd process the vendor daemons continue to run Then when you restart the 1mgrd the restart of the vendor daemons will fail and you will see messages like the following in your log file MULTIPLE xxx servers running Please kill and restart license daemon If you see such messages you should kill all xxx daemon processes and restart the license manager Q Do I have to restart the license manager when I just change expiration dates and passwords LeonardoSpectrumInstallation 4 A It may not be necessary to stop and restart the license manager when a DAEMON or
